Here is a basic bio:
Ghost Tower began in Summer of 2007 when longtime metal enthusiasts Ameven (vocals) and Matt Preston (guitar) joined forces to write and record original music on their own terms. Some of their main influences are Mercyful Fate, John Arch-era Fates Warning, Abattoir, thrash and speed metal from the 1980s, little-known NWOBHM singles, 1970s Camel and other good progressive '70s rock, Nasty Savage, Crimson Glory, Iron Maiden, Candlemass, Black Sabbath, Goblin, obscure '70s and '80s horror films and the overall attitude and sound of dark old school underground metal. Despite an otherwise fleeting band lineup, Ghost Tower self-released a raw demo in 2008, "Curse of the Black Blood" in 2010 and, finding their true sound, "Head of Night" in February 2012.
